Handle the "und" locale in ICU versions 54 and older. The "und" locale is an alternative spelling of the root locale, but it was not recognized until ICU 55. To maintain common behavior across all supported ICU versions, check for "und" and replace with "root" before opening. Previously, the lack

Implement find_my_exec()'s path normalization using realpath(3). Replace the symlink-chasing logic in find_my_exec with realpath(3), which has been required by POSIX since SUSv2. (Windows lacks realpath(), but there we can use _fullpath() which is functionally equivalent.) The main benefit of th

libpq: Add sslcertmode option to control client certificates The sslcertmode option controls whether the server is allowed and/or required to request a certificate from the client. There are three modes: - "allow" is the default and follows the current behavior, where a configured client certific
